Transaction 99fa08d9833f742a79ca2c17b0cdd1480469b38eb8dcf64764eca441d33b468d

2 Input
2 Outputs
  • 99fa08d9833f742a79ca2c17b0cdd1480469b38eb8dcf64764eca441d33b468d:0
  • value  610614
    address  1F5JpXX8j9o5f1yp9EqySviG963GsSTLBg
  • 99fa08d9833f742a79ca2c17b0cdd1480469b38eb8dcf64764eca441d33b468d:1
  • value  2766962
    address  3DY2DaRefNG4EGnrJWhAEHSrDqSNegCZAS